Macrocyclic polyamine lactam synthesis by diphenyl ether closure of 23-, 24- and 28-membered rings

Abstract

Novel 23-, 24- and 28-membered cyclic polyamine amides (cinnamamides) have been prepared by closure of diphenyl ethers; functionalized conjugates of spermidine and spermine underwent intramolecular aromatic nucleophilic substitution to afford nitro-substituted analogues of cadabicine class (24-membered polyamine lactam) alkaloids.
